Furthermore, the treatise does not merely offer a static analysis of narrators but instead embraces a dynamic perspective, introducing concepts of verification and the role of biographical literature in the evaluation process. This aspect is critical; it provides readers with tools to navigate the labyrinth of Islamic historiography. By drawing parallels with contemporary methodologies in historiography, the text fosters an environment conducive to critical thinking and scholarly rigor.
Readers may also find detailed discussions concerning controversial narrators, wherein the author engages with differing opinions among scholars. Each dispute is examined through a lens of reasoned argumentation, allowing readers to appreciate the depth of scholarly discourse that surrounds hadith science. Such engagement serves not only to clarify contentious issues but also to exemplify the intellectual vibrancy that characterizes Shia scholarship.
In terms of structure, “Tanqih al-maqal” is meticulously organized, guiding readers progressively through its themes. The delineation of sections is intentional, facilitating ease of navigation through complex concepts. Each chapter builds upon the last, creating an academic tapestry that interweaves different strands of thought and methodology, leading to a comprehensive understanding of the field.
